Lumen Technologies (LUMN) Debt Ratio (2009 - 2026)

Lumen Technologies (LUMN) posted quarterly Debt Ratio of 0.42 for Q1 2026, down 19.64% year-over-year from 0.53 in Q1 2025, and down 16.67% quarter-over-quarter from 0.51 in Q4 2025.

Lumen Technologies (LUMN) Debt Ratio (2009 - 2026) Analysis & Trends

Lumen Technologies' Debt Ratio history runs 18 years deep, the most recent figure standing at 0.42 for Q1 2026.

  • In Q1 2026, Debt Ratio fell 19.64% year-over-year to 0.42; the TTM figure through Mar 2026 stood at 0.42 (down 19.64% YoY), while the FY2025 annual figure was 0.51, down 5.0% from the prior year.
  • Debt Ratio for Q1 2026 stood at 0.42, down from 0.51 in the prior quarter.
  • The five-year high for Debt Ratio was 0.59 in Q4 2023, with the low at 0.42 in Q1 2026.
  • The 5-year median for Debt Ratio is 0.53 (2025), against an average of 0.51.
  • The sharpest annual moves came in 2023 and 2026: Debt Ratio jumped 30.28% in 2023, then retreated 19.64% in 2026.
  • Lumen Technologies' Debt Ratio stood at 0.45 in 2022, then surged by 30.28% to 0.59 in 2023, then retreated by 9.02% to 0.53 in 2024, then dropped by 5.0% to 0.51 in 2025, then declined by 16.67% to 0.42 in 2026.
